You’d Think They Would Care…
0 Comments Published by Hilary July 17th, 2007 in Contraception: Hormonal, Adventures in Missing the Point…but even environmentalists like their contraceptives.
The EPA has been finding intersex fish in Boulder (Colorado) Creek. The culprit? Synthetic hormones from contraceptives. Not that this is anything new, but what is frustrating is the inaction of environmental activists who spout the usual rhetoric.
